What’s the difference between Japanese Akita and American Akita

American Akitas are larger and heavier, come in a variety of colors, and often have black fur on their muzzle. Japanese Akitas, on the other hand, are smaller, orange-white, brindle, or bright, clean, and may not have the new black mask.
